 ♥Otomodachi!♥

 Otomodachi is a magazine aimed at young children~! There are fun and edicational parts~♪ I think if you're studying Japanese and you like things like PreCure, Sanrio etc. this would be a really fun for reading practice~!♥♥ It's also super good if you only know hiragana but not katakana, because the katakana have furigana (little hiragana) over them!♪

♥Pucchi Gumi!♥

 
Pucchi Gumi is a magazine filled with different kawaii characters and series like Tamagotchi, Pretty Rhythm, Aikatsu!, Jewel Pets, MofuMofu... and maybe you can guess the next two? I'll put them in romaji instead of the english names ww~~ Doubutsu no Mori and Tomodachi wa Mahou!♥ This is one of my favourites, so I'll deffie be getting this each month!♥♥

 
Front cover and free gift~!♪ Ichigo from Aikatsu! is on the cover~~!(*^O^*) I'm hoping to cosplay her sometime!♥♥

 
The free gift is a light box~! A toy was recently released called "ComiTab", which is like this but bigger~! You can use it to trace things like manga and characters from magazines and then you can colour them~♪ It sounds pretty neat! Again, clever marketing in the form of a "taster" as a free gift ww~

♥Chara Parfait!♥

 
Chara Parfait is my other favourite~ so I'll deffie be buying this again next month too!♥♥ It's very similar to Pucchi Gumi in its demographic, but has more comics, and a lot about really cute videogames!♥ Unlike the other magazines, this reads left to right.♪
